Send Flowers to the Family Offer Condolences or MemoryMATHILDA SCHULTZ (nee MOHOR) It is with deep sadness we announce the passing of our mother Mathilda Schultz on Saturday, March 31, 2007, at the age of 85 years. Mom was born October 30, 1921, in Josefberg, Poland. She was predeceased by her parents in Poland, one brother, two sisters in Germany, her husbands, Philipp Gottel and Albert Schultz and son-in-law Herman Buss. Mom is survived by daughters, Elfriede Buss and Rita and Brian Pischke, grandchildren, Rodney and Gillian Buss, Terry and Treena Buss, Denise and Darren Murash, Heather and Amber Pischke, great-grandchildren, Aimey, Shandal and Tyler Murash, Mikayla and Ryan Buss and Kade Buss; also by niece Connie and Klaus Knocke in B.C., nephew Erick Dressler in Germany, cousins, Elsie Wesa, Shirley Truthwaite and family. Mom came to Canada with her daughter in 1950. She married Albert in 1951 and worked on the farm for 37 years. In 1988 she moved to Beausejour and enjoyed most of those years.
